Description

Offered is a very attractive and mostly mid-grade near-complete set of the 1941 Play Ball series issued by Gum, Inc., one of card collecting's all-time classic gum issues. This full-color near-complete set is composed of 66 of the 72 total cards and includes many Hall of Famers and stars, highlighted by Mel Ott, Carl Hubbell, and Hank Greenberg. Missing the following six cards for completion: #13 Foxx, 14 Williams, 54 Reese, 70 Dickey, 71 J. DiMaggio, and 72 Gomez. Condition is 28% Ex or slightly better, 58% Vg to Vg-Ex, and 14% lesser. We have selected four cards for grading and encapsulation by SGC. Keys: #1 Miller (Gd), 6 Hubbell (Gd), 8 Ott (Gd), 10 Vaughan (EX 5), 15 Cronin (Vg), 18 Greenberg (EX/NM 6), 19 Gehringer (VG/EX+ 4.5), 20 Ruffing (Vg), 39 Henrich (Vg-Ex), 60 Klein (Vg), 61 V. DiMaggio (Vg-Ex), 63 D. DiMaggio (Vg-Ex+), and 64 Doerr (EX 5). One of the great things about card collecting is that the classic card sets can be collected in any condition, on any budget. Spanning several grades, this is a very attractive near-complete set that we think any collector would find extremely appealing, and one that could serve as an excellent start toward the assembly of a complete set, or serve as an impressive representation of the issue. Total: 66 cards.
